Ingredients

  1. 1 cupwhite sugar
  2. 1 cuppacked brown sugar
  3. 1 cupbutter
  4. 1/2 cupcorn syrup
  5. 1 pinchcream of tartar
  6. 1 tspbaking soda

Cooking Instructions

  1. 1

    Place popped popping corn in a large roasting pan.

  2. 2

    In a heavy saucepan stir together sugars,, butter, corn syrup and cream of tartar.

  3. 3

    Bring to boil and boil for 5 minutes without stirring.

  4. 4

    Remove from heat, add baking soda and stir well.

  5. 5

    Pour sugar mixture over popcorn and mix to coat well.

  6. 6

    Bake in 200°F. oven for one hour, stirring every 10 minutes.

  7. 7

    Let cool, stirring occasionally.

  8. 8

    Store in airtight container.

  9. 9

    Makes 20 cups, and disappears quickly!
